Original Description
In Pierre-Auguste Renoir’s tender masterpiece Petit Garçon au Porte-Plume (Claude Renoir écrivant), the artist captures an intimate moment of his young son Claude engrossed in writing. Painted in 1908 during Renoir’s late period, the work radiates warmth through its soft brushstrokes and golden hues, embodying the artist’s signature Impressionist style while subtly embracing a more structured, classical influence. The boy’s focused expression and the delicate play of light on his face and hands reveal Renoir’s mastery of portraying childhood innocence and domestic tranquility. This painting holds a special place in art history as part of Renoir’s deeply personal explorations of family life, bridging Impressionism’s spontaneity with timeless emotional depth. Its smaller scale (approximately 41 x 33 cm) enhances its charm, drawing viewers into a private, lyrical world.
